Transaction 15a96cd267804504c6db94a376a1356c6fca6fb16eb5dfc201a1868449d552f2
1 Input
1 Output
-
15a96cd267804504c6db94a376a1356c6fca6fb16eb5dfc201a1868449d552f2:0
- value
- 32899
- script pubkey
- OP_0 OP_PUSHBYTES_20 178674d40cf595429f6b0b3414fc8a9848618e4d
- address
- bc1qz7r8f4qv7k2598mtpv6pfly2npyxrrjdyx2utf